I'm paranoid when uninstalling apps because I'm under the impression that uninstalling them directly without using the "Clear Data" function on the app's page first will result in leftover files somewhere in the phone's system. So to finally get an answer, I'm asking here, in Lollipop, when I uninstall apps directly, do I not need to do "Clear Data" first?
1 Answer
Force stop → clear data → uninstall is the same as uninstalling app directly as far as removing app data is considered. It's just an extra step with no added benefit.
Force stop option is primarily to troubleshoot apps when they misbehave
Either method does not guarantee removal of all app data - you would need root to ensure that. See Can a app store data beyond uninstallation?